abstract = "The green synthesis method is a promising new approach to the synthesis of metal nanoparticles and their oxides. Green synthesis involves reducing the negative impact on the environment by using substances contained in various biological sources as reducing agents and stabilizers. This paper provides an overview of the green synthesis method to obtaining metal nanoparticles and their oxides. Due to economic efficiency, significantly reduced toxicity and negative environmental impact and environmental friendliness, numerous studies have been conducted on the production of nanoparticles using plant extracts and their promising application in numerous industries and science. The nanotechnological aspect of the green synthesis method consists in new possibilities for the formation of special nanoar-chitectonics of nanoparticles and control of their parameters, including the possibility of creating porous hierarchical nanoparticles with a complex texture.",
